Bloomberg looking for news editor for Nairobi bureau

Share
Share

Bloomberg News is searching for a news editor for its Nairobi bureau in Kenya. The holder of the position will assist with its coverage in Kenya and East Africa.

Responsibilities include generating and shaping ideas, editing copy, coaching and mentoring reporters and interacting with fellow editors on the team as well as across the organisation.

“The successful applicant will be able to work with teams to produce breaking news stories under deadline pressure, as well as longer in-depth features, ensuring all are clear, comprehensive and accurate,” the company says in a job advert.

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ience

Previous financial journalism experience is essential – Ability to work gracefully under pressure

Proven success in generating story ideas and producing outstanding copy

Ability to coach reporters on interviewing and writing is required

Knowledge of the economy, financial markets, and business
